    Jan.29 Cotto's Fighting

    Nelson Dieppa (21-2-2, 12KOs) will defend his WBO jr flyweight title against former champion Alex Sánchez (31-4-1, 21KOs) on January 29 at the Rubén Rodriguez Coliseum in Bayamón, Puerto Rico. The world title fight will headline an attractive card presented by PR Best Boxing Promotions. Also in action in twelve round bouts are former champion Eric Morel (34-1, 18 KOs) vs TBA for the NABO superfly belt and unbeaten José Miguel Cotto (24-0, 16 KOs) vs TBA for the NABO 130lb belt. The card will be available on pay-per-view in Puerto Rico.
